WebJan 20, 2024 · Atrial fibrillation can lead to a number of problems, including: dizziness. feeling faint. shortness of breath. fast and irregular heartbeat (palpitations) feeling very tired. Some people with atrial fibrillation have no symptoms and are completely unaware that their heart rate is irregular. Find out more about the symptoms of atrial fibrillation. WebApr 6, 2024 · Sudden cardiac arrest is an electrical malfunction of the heart that causes the heart to suddenly stop beating. Causes and risk factors include drug abuse, abnormal heart rhythms, heart disease, smoking, ventricular fibrillation, high cholesterol, or previous heart attack (not inclusive). WebPeople age 65 and older are much more likely than younger people to suffer a heart attack, to have a stroke, or to develop coronary heart disease (commonly called heart disease) and heart failure. Heart disease is also a major cause of disability, limiting the activity and eroding the quality of life of millions of older people.
